`
sbfivwsll
  • 浏览: 59835 次
  • 性别: Icon_minigender_1
  • 来自: 四川
社区版块
存档分类
最新评论

eclipse中编辑log4j 的xml配置文件时,自动提示

阅读更多

方法1. 配置log4j.dtd文件: Windows -> Preferences -> XML -> XML Catalog 点击 Add.. 添加一个XML Catalog Entry

在弹出的窗口如下配置:

Location: jar:file:F:/software/sts-2.3.3.M2/plugins/org.apache.log4j_1.2.13.v200903072027.jar!/org/apache/log4j/xml/log4j.dtd

Key Type: Public ID

Key: -//LOGGER

注意:Location中的log4j.dtd文件的位置使用的是我本机STS的plugins里自带的log4jxxx.jar中的的文件,所以URI的前缀是 jar:file:

此处也可以改成系统文件的位置,如 F:\software\sts-2.3.3.M2\plugins\log4j.dtd 只要这个log4j.dtd文件存在就行了。

然后将log4j.xml中的DOCTYPE声明修改为:


< ?xml version="1.0" encoding="UTF-8" ?>

<!DOCTYPE log4j:configuration PUBLIC "-//LOGGER" "log4j.dtd">

<log4j:configuration xmlns:log4j="http://jakarta.apache.org/log4j/">

</log4j:configuration>

重新编译项目就可以了。

 

 

方法2.直接将log4j.dtd文件拷贝到与log4j.xml文件的同级目录下即可,但这样做每个用到log4j.xml的地方都要拷贝一次。

这种方法下DOCTYPE不用更改。

分享到:
评论

相关推荐

    usn-eclipselink-slf4j:用于通过 SLF4J 记录消息的 EclipseLink SessionLog 实现

    usn-eclipselink-slf4j 用于通过记录消息的 实现。 背景 是公认的 Java 持久性框架和 JPA 2.0 的参考实现。 是一种公认​​的 Java 日志 API 和框架,用于在必要时在一个应用程序中桥接不同的 Java 日志系统。 ...

    spring mvc项目

    spring mvc maven项目,导入IDEA后无报错,需要在IDEA中...该项目使用servlet3.0规范,无web.xml,无spring.xml等配置文件,所有的配置均通过Java Config、注解搞定,项目中还集成了log4j2技术,以及前端html文件等。

    eclipse+spring+ibatis搭建项目基础代码

    自己亲自用eclipse+spring+ibatis搭建的基本框架,含有所需的JAR包,下载后只需更改sql2005的连接字符串,即WEB-INF/db-context.xml中的配置,并更改ibatis的xml文件中的sql语句即可运行。

    《程序天下:J2EE整合详解与典型案例》光盘源码

    6.3.6 在代码中使用Log4j 6.4 改进Log4j 6.5 小结 第七章 Ant使用指南 7.1 Ant介绍 7.1.1 Ant简介 7.1.2 为什么要使用Ant 7.2 建立Ant的开发环境 7.2.1 下载Ant 7.2.2 配置Ant 7.3 Ant的使用方法 7.3.1 Ant能完成的...

    搞定J2EE:STRUTS+SPRING+HIBERNATE整合详解与典型案例 (2)

    6.3.6 在代码中使用Log4j 6.4 改进Log4j 6.5 小结 第七章 Ant使用指南 7.1 Ant介绍 7.1.1 Ant简介 7.1.2 为什么要使用Ant 7.2 建立Ant的开发环境 7.2.1 下载Ant 7.2.2 配置Ant 7.3 Ant的使用方法 7.3.1 Ant能完成的...

    搞定J2EE:STRUTS+SPRING+HIBERNATE整合详解与典型案例 (1)

    6.3.6 在代码中使用Log4j 6.4 改进Log4j 6.5 小结 第七章 Ant使用指南 7.1 Ant介绍 7.1.1 Ant简介 7.1.2 为什么要使用Ant 7.2 建立Ant的开发环境 7.2.1 下载Ant 7.2.2 配置Ant 7.3 Ant的使用方法 7.3.1 Ant能完成的...

    搞定J2EE:STRUTS+SPRING+HIBERNATE整合详解与典型案例 (3)

    6.3.6 在代码中使用Log4j 6.4 改进Log4j 6.5 小结 第七章 Ant使用指南 7.1 Ant介绍 7.1.1 Ant简介 7.1.2 为什么要使用Ant 7.2 建立Ant的开发环境 7.2.1 下载Ant 7.2.2 配置Ant 7.3 Ant的使用方法 7.3.1 Ant能完成的...

    免费下载:自己整理的java学习资料

    log4j使用教程.txt struts_action.txt struts标签.chm swing02.doc Tomcat.chm webAndXml.pdf 正则表达式.chm 网页常用的jsp 脚本.doc JSF入门简体中文版 struts标签中文 config 设计模式:Java语言中的应用.pdf ...

    智能开发平台 DOROODO

    3.在eclipse中引入doroodo,修改config/db/doroodo_defult.properties配置文件 +++++++++++++++++++[doroodo_defult.properties]中几个需要改的部分+++++++++++++++++++ hibernate.default_schema=doroodo ----&gt;...

    InsurancePlus

    该文件位于 Eclipse 中的 Servers-Tomcat 下设置日志在“服务器”下双击 Tomcat -&gt; 打开启动配置 -&gt; 在“VM 参数”下的参数选项卡中添加以下 -Dlog4j.debug -Dlog4j.configuration = log4j.properties -&gt; 在 ...

    java吐血精华大奉送,你要的都能找到(最新版本)

    技术人员也过个年吧,java_吐血奉献_超值大礼包(最新版本)_含struts,hibernate,spring,log4j,web.xml配置详解,java分页大全,cvs教程,tomcat,swing教程,jboss,及各种框架的配置文件范例

    Jetty中文手册

    配置文件 jetty.xml–Server configuration jetty-web.xml–Web App configuration jetty-env.xml–JNDI configuration webdefault.xml–Pre-web.xml configuration override-web.xml–Post-web.xml configuration ...

    ApkIDE——安卓反编译

    增加对.samli、.xml的文件修改的监视功能,以便在使用了外部编辑器修改此类文件后能通知用户重新加载修改过的文件。 手动清理旧项目时改为线程方式,避免假死问题。 解决下拉列表的界面语言翻译问题。 小东和小西被...

    Maven权威指南 很精典的学习教程,比ANT更好用

    本例中所用的技术 7.2. simple-parent项目 7.3. simple-model模块 7.4. simple-weather模块 7.5. simple-persist模块 7.6. simple-webapp模块 7.7. 运行这个Web应用 7.8. simple-command模块 7.9. 运行这...

    java吐血精华大奉送,你要的都能找到

    java_吐血奉献_超值大礼包_含struts,hibernate,spring,log4j,web.xml配置详解,java分页大全,cvs教程,tomcat,swing教程,及各种框架的配置文件范例

    中国移动ONENET平台测试项目-基于Springboot+源代码+文档说明

    src/main/resources/log.xml:系统日志配置 ## 项目备注 1、该资源内项目代码都经过测试运行成功,功能ok的情况下才上传的,请放心下载使用! 2、本项目适合计算机相关专业(如计科、人工智能、通信工程、自动化、...

    数据库系统原理课程设计,基于 SSM 框架的医院药品库存管理系统+源代码+文档说明

    - [X] [2.7 配置 log4j](#配置-log4j) - [X] [2.8 集成基于 Bootstrap 前端框架的 ACE 管理系统页面模板](#集成基于-Bootstrap-前端框架的-ACE-管理系统页面模板) - [X] [2.9 导入 Apache Taglibs 的 ja ------...

    librec:更改librec(https

    读取内部配置参数为默认值时有内部配置,例如,当运行java -jar librec.jar ,它应该读取内部的配置文件,例如librec.conf , log4j.xml 。 InputStream configStream =this . getClass() . getClassLoader() . ...

    spring4.3.9相关jar包

    外部依赖Commons Logging, (Log4J)。 spring-beans.jar(必须):这 个jar 文件是所有应用都要用到的,它包含访问配置文件、创建和管理bean 以及进行Inversion of Control / Dependency Injection(IoC/DI)操作...

    RunnerManager::collision:校园赛事管理系统,基于SSM框架一个比赛裁判管理系统,主要技术(SpringMVC + Spring + Mybatis + Hui + Jquery + Ueditor)

    日志:log4j AOP 前端框架:Hui 其他插件 快速上手 1.运行环境和所需工具 建议使用以下环境,避免版本带来的问题编译器:Eclipse项目构建工具:Maven数据库:Mysql JDK版本:jdk1.8 Tomcat版本:Tomcat8.x 2.初始化...

Global site tag (gtag.js) - Google Analytics